Financial update RoseAnn
The
final 2009 numbers are posted. We have a net income of $2500, but when the mortgage
payments are added in, there is a net loss of $8380. The Cash accounts
comparing Feb 2009 to Feb 2010 are down $18,000 because mortgage payments are
included this year.
RoseAnn
suggests we look into automatic clearing house payments so the money automatically
comes out of giver’s checking accounts. There would be a 25 cent
transaction fee and a one-time 50 cent set-up fee per giver plus $25 a month
for web hosting. Using this method would take less time for counters to process
and might help avoid the summer slump in finances. 95% of church membership is
online. RoseAnn will research this further and post more information on
electronic guide to church giving on the Vestry website. Further discussion
will be on the April agenda.

Sabbatical suggestion Carol Barker
Rand’s plans for his sabbatical next month have been
complicated by the Diocese decision not to fund any sabbaticals. Normally,
one-third of sabbatical money has been provided by the diocese subsidy. Sue
will advise the church of this situation this Sunday, Greg will speak to the
matter on March 21st . If not enough money comes in to pay one-third
share ($2500), Annelie will organize a follow-up request from the congregation.
As a last resort, we would take the money out of the church’s mission share.
Rand’s last Sunday before his sabbatical will be April 11th . We
will have a laying on of hands during the service. Annelie will arrange a cake.
Rand’s
plans involve visits to Chicago, the Holy Land, and a retreat center in New Mexico.
